I propose to take Questions Nos. 122, 123 and 124 together.

My Department implements a programme of continuous review in relation to ICT security in order to keep up to date with current threat levels given that cyber security is a multi-faceted challenge that is constantly evolving.

In common with other Government Departments, my Department has in place comprehensive arrangements to support ICT security and receives regular advice on these matters from the relevant authorities including the Office of the Government Chief Information Officer(OGCIO) and the National Cyber Security Centre(NCSC)

My Department places a high priority on cyber security and implements a security-by-design and defence-in-depth approach to cyber security. The defence-in-depth security strategy is achieved through the effective combination of people, processes, and technology to support the implementation of appropriate security measures and provisions. From an operational and security perspective, it would not be appropriate for me to disclose the specific measures taken in relation to cyber security.
